layui获取当前行点击对象和行数

Posted ketoli

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了layui获取当前行点击对象和行数相关的知识,希望对你有一定的参考价值。

{
data: "billNo", bSortable: false, width: 100, className: ‘center‘,
render: function (data, type, full, meta) {
if(isNull(full.fbsStatus) || full.fbsStatus == 0) {
var html = ‘‘;
html += ‘<button class="layui-btn" data-row="‘ + meta.row + ‘" onclick="$genNisReceivable(this)" type="button">‘ + bt.lang(‘common.button.select‘) + ‘</button>‘;
return html;
}
}
},
上面是datatable返回的每一行对象,前端html中table的id是appTable,则js中
$shouBillView = function (el) {
var data = layui.jquery("#appTable").DataTable().row(layui.jquery(el).data("row")).data();//获取当前点击行对象,
var row = layui.jquery(el).data("row");、、获取当前行号
var id = data.id;//id
var billId = $("billId"+id);
var url = "/bill/accebill/abvoucherinfoVice/viewBillInfo?billId="+billId;
parent.layer.open({
type: 2,
area: [‘850px‘, ‘530px‘],
maxmin: true,
content: basePath + url,
});
}




以上是关于layui获取当前行点击对象和行数的主要内容,如果未能解决你的问题,请参考以下文章

如何在 data.table 中返回行数和行数?

layui table 行点击事件与列点击事件冲突

POI获取Excel列数和行数的方法

请我这种onclick事件,点击获取是当前行数的内容

MySQL 表和行数

layui数据表格批量删除